Two long, parallel wires carry currents of I1 = 3.15 A and I2 = 5.15 A in the directions indicated in the figure below, where d = 21.5 cm. Take the positive x direction to be to the right.

(a) Find the magnitude and direction of the magnetic field at a point midway between the wires.

Explanation / Answer


apply magnetic field B due to each wire as B = uoi/2pi R

so

at mid point between them, r = d/2 = 21.5/2 = 10.75 cm

so

Bnet in middle = uoi/2pir + uoi/2pi R

Bnet = 4*3.14 e-7 * (3.15 +5.15)/(2*3.14 * 0.1075)

Bnet = 1.544 *10^-5 tesla
